Mataki 1: Ciki da Matsi
Tsarin yana farawa da injin dizal-zuciyar janareta.
Samun iska: Injin yana zana iska mai tsabta, tacewa ta bawul ɗin sha.
Matsi: piston yana motsawa sama, yana matsawa wannan iska a cikin silinda. Wannan matsawa yana ƙara ƙarfin iska da zafin jiki da matsa lamba.
Wannan yanayin matsa lamba yana da mahimmanci ga mataki na gaba kuma yana nuna mahimmancin abubuwan da aka gyara daidaitattun abubuwan da aka dogara da su. aikin injin dizal.
Mataki na 2: allurar mai da konewa
Wannan lokaci shine inda man fetur ya hadu da iska mai matsa lamba, samar da wutar lantarki.
Allura: A lokacin da ake matsawa, wani babban injin mai mai matsa lamba yana fesa daidai gwargwado, dizal a cikin dakin konewa.
Konewa: iska mai zafi, matsatsin iska nan take ta kunna tururin mai. Fashewar da ta haifar ya tilasta fistan zuwa ƙasa da gagarumin ƙarfi39. Wannan “buguwar wutar lantarki” ita ce farkon tushen makamashin injina.
Madaidaicin tsarin allurar mai shine muhimmin al'amari na ci gaba aikin injin dizal, kai tsaye tasiri yadda ya dace da tattalin arzikin man fetur.
Mataki 3: Mayar da Makamashi Makamashi zuwa Wutar Lantarki
Dole ne a canza makamashin injina daga injin zuwa wutar lantarki mai amfani.
Canja wurin Juyawa: Motsin linzamin piston yana jujjuya zuwa motsi na juyawa ta crankshaft. Ana canja wannan jujjuya kai tsaye zuwa juzu'in mai canzawa.
Induction Electromagnetic: Yayin da rotor ke jujjuyawa a cikin stator, filin maganadisu yana yanke saman iskar jan ƙarfe na stator. Wannan aikin yana haifar da canjin wutar lantarki (AC) a cikin iska.
Zane da kayan madaidaicin, musamman ingantacciyar iskar tagulla, suna da mahimmanci don ingantaccen jujjuya makamashi a cikin kowane maɗaukaki. aikin injin dizal.
Mataki na 4: Tsarin Wutar Lantarki da Kashewa
Mataki na ƙarshe ya ƙunshi tace wutar lantarki da sarrafa sharar gida.
Ƙarfin wutar lantarki: Danyen wutar lantarki daga mai canzawa yana wucewa ta hanyar mai sarrafa wutar lantarki. Wannan yana tabbatar da ƙarfin wutar lantarki ya kasance mai ƙarfi da daidaito, yana kare kayan aikin da aka haɗa daga jujjuyawar wuta.
Ƙarfafawa: Bayan konewa, ana fitar da iskar gas mai zafi daga silinda kuma a bi da su ta hanyar tsarin shaye-shaye, yawanci ciki har da na'ura don rage hayaniya kuma, a cikin tsarin zamani, kayan aikin bayan magani don rage yawan hayaki.
